About the Program The Newcomer Youth Connections to Success (NYCS) is a dynamic program designed to support newcomer youth (ages 15–18) in successfully transitioning into the Canadian education system and future workforce.

The program focuses on building confidence, social connections, and early career direction through mentorship, skills development, and exposure to post-secondary and career pathways.

International Skills Applied to Geriatrics (ISAGE) bridge training program is delivered from the North office in partnership with George Brown College and other stakeholders.
